title = "Transceiver optimization for multi-user multi-antenna two-way relay channels",
abstract = "In this paper, we study a multi-user multi-antenna two-way relay system, where a multi-antenna base station (BS) exchanges uplink and downlink signals with multiple users via a multi-antenna amplify-and-forward relay station (RS). We jointly design the BS and RS transceivers, aiming to maximize the system bidirectional sum rate under inter-user interference free constraint. Since the optimization problem is non-convex, we employ alternating optimization algorithm to design the transmit and receive weighting matrices at the BS and RS. Simulation results show that the proposed solution offers higher bidirectional sum rate than existing schemes.",
